  • The Meaning of Knead | Definition of Knead

    Verb
    Knead is the act of Working dough or clay into a uniform mixture by pressing, folding, and stretching it with the hands.
    itis also the act of pressing and squeeze muscles to relieve tension or pain.

    Examples in a Sentence Respectivly.
    She began to knead the dough on the floured surface.
    He asked his partner to knead his shoulders after a long day at work.

  • The Meaning of Mandazi | Definition of Mandazi

    noun
    Is a form of fried bread usualy made in eastern Africa.

    The roots of mandazi trace back to the Swahili coast of East Africa, where it has been a staple in the local cuisine for centuries. The name “mandazi” itself holds significance, with its origins believed to stem from the Arabic word “mandazi,” meaning “having fat.”

  • The Meaning of Noun | Definition of Noun

    a noun is a word that refers to a person, place, or thing.

    Nouns can be singular (‘one sandwich’) or plural (‘two sandwiches’), although some nouns take the same form regardless (‘one sheep,’ ‘two sheep’). Nouns can also refer to concepts (information) that cannot be counted and singular entities (Neptune) that cannot be pluralized.
    Sentences can have one noun (“Theo ran quickly.”) or more than one (“Theo ran quickly across the field.”) but some sentences don’t have any (“Run, quickly!”).

  • The Meaning of Onions | Definition of Onions

    Noun
    Singular: onion
    Plural: onions
    An onion is a plant (Allium cepa) of the lily family, having an edible bulb with a strong, sharp smell and taste. The succulent bulb of this plant forms close, concentric layers of leaf bases.
    Onions come in various colors, including white, yellow, and red, and has a sharp, spicy flavor when raw. Onions are commonly used in cooking to add flavor and depth to dishes. They can be chopped, sliced, or minced and used in soups, stews, stir-fries, sauces, and salads. Onions can also be caramelized or sautéed to bring out their natural sweetness.

  • The Meaning of Potatoes| Definition of Potatoes

    Noun
    It is a starchy edible tuber: A potato is the round or oval tuber of a plant found in a family Solanum tuberosum, which is a staple food in many parts of the world. It has brown, red, or yellow skin and white, yellow, or purple flesh.
    The plant itself: The potato is also the name for the plant that produces these tubers, a herbaceous annual native to South America.

    In English colloquial speech and slang, “potato” also carries several extended meanings, such as referring to “an unimportant or insignificant person” (small potato), “a controversial or problematic issue or person that is difficult to deal with” (hot potato), “a person who spends a lot of time sitting and watching television” (couch potato), or “an internet addict” (internet potato).

  • The Meaning of Cardamom | Definition of Cardamom

    Cardamom refers to highly soght after herbs within the Elettaria (green) and Amomum (black) genera of the ginger (Zingiberaceae) family. It is native to the moist forests of southern India. The fruit may be collected from wild plants, most the global Cardamom production is cultivated in India, Sri Lanka and Guatemala.

    Where to Buy Cardamom
    Ground cardamom is readily available and found in grocery stores, but it’s best to buy it in the form of whole pods if you can find them (and have the time to do a little spice grinding).

    Cardamom Substitutes
    What can be substituted for cardamom? One option is coriander, which also has a floral flavor somewhat similar to cardamom flavor. Ginger, nutmeg and cinnamon are other options some people use as a cardamom substitute, but remember that cardamom taste is very unique so there is no perfect cardamom replacement.

    How to Use and Store It
    This spice pairs well with flavors like cinnamon, vanilla, almond, ginger, clove, coconut and rose. It adds a complex depth when combined with these flavors.
    What is cardamom used for? It’s a popular additive in the Indian chai tea. Cacao and cardamom are a great pairing as well. It can also be used in savory stews and soups, all types of breads, as well as sweeter dishes like puddings, cakes, pancakes and pies. It’s a great spice to use for steeping in hot liquids like green and mint teas or cold smoothies too.
    This herb can be used whole or steeped in hot water and various liquids to create cardamom tea and other infused beverages. The seeds can also be removed from the cardamom pod to be ground and added into various dishes and smoothies.
    A benefit of the pods is that they stay fresh longer and are more potent. This spice can be stored for up to a year when purchased in the pod form and can be ground with a mortar and pestle or spice grinder.

    What is cardamom powder used for?
    Cardamom is an important ingredient in many herbal mixes such as in the African Berbere, curry powders, Garam Masala, Ras El Hanout, etc… In India, cardamom is a common ingredient in meat and vegetable dishes or stews. In Northern Europe cardamom is used to add extra flavour to pastries, such as Christmas cakes, cakes, biscuits, muffins, sandwiches and jams. It lends a great flavour to preparations with fruit such as apples, pears and oranges.
    What is cardamom powder’s Flaver
    Cardamom powder has a fresh, floral taste with a warm, powerful and spicy aroma. The powder is the ground black seed from the green cardamom pod. Cardamom strengthens both savoury and sweet flavours. It is a seasoning in dishes from India, Scandinavia and Arabic cuisine.

    Nutrition Facts Cardamom Powder
    One tablespoon of ground cardamom contains about:
    18 calories
    4 grams carbohydrates
    0.6 gram protein
    0.4 gram fat
    1.6 grams fiber
    1.6 milligrams manganese (80 percent DV)
    0.8 milligrams iron (4.4 percent DV)
    13 milligrams magnesium (3.3 percent DV)
    0.4 milligrams zinc (2.7 percent DV)
    22 milligrams calcium (2.2 percent DV)
    65 milligrams potassium (1.9 percent DV)
    10 milligrams phosphorus (1 percent DV)
